Reality TV. You already watch it. You already have opinions. It's Called Reality gives you somewhere to take them seriously. Hosts Willow and Briana have been texting each other about their reality TV obsessions for years. Now they're yapping about it on a podcast. Every episode covers a different franchise, going deeper than the drama to explore the beauty standards, the bias, the power dynamics, and what it all reveals about the world we actually live in, and about us. It's the discourse for people who give a shit.
